Damper Repair
The damper in a Baychester masonry chimney takes a beating. Humidity from the nearby bay rusts steel throat dampers; heat cycling cracks cast-iron frames. A stuck or broken damper wastes 20-30% of your heated air up the flue. Chimney Repair in Baychester for a damper costs $180-$450 for a standard throat damper, or $600-$950 if we’re installing a top-sealing damper from Gelco to stop the downdraft that coastal wind patterns create here. We stock common sizes and can usually complete the repair same-day.

Firebox Repair
The firebox, the actual chamber where combustion happens, is where we find the most urgent safety issues in Baychester homes. Decades of oil or gas exhaust, combined with the acidic condensate that forms in cool, oversized flues, erodes mortar joints and cracks firebrick. A firebox refractory panel replacement runs $400-$800; full firebox rebuild with HeatShield cerfractory foam or traditional firebrick is $1,200-$2,400. We document every crack with photos and explain whether it’s cosmetic or a genuine fire hazard.

Fireplace Conversion
Converting from wood to gas, or from an old oil-side chimney to a functional fireplace vent, requires more than a burner swap. In Baychester, we often need to reline the flue, resize the opening, and verify clearances to combustibles in walls built to 1950s standards. Conversions start around $1,800 for a simple gas log set on an existing line, and run $3,500-$6,000 for a full insert conversion with liner and gas work. We’ll inspect first and tell you honestly whether your chimney is a candidate.

Common Fireplace Services Problems We See in Baychester Homes
- Deteriorated clay flue liners in oil-conversion chimneys. The original liners in Baychester’s 1950s brick homes were never meant for the acidic condensate produced by modern gas appliances. We find spalled clay, missing sections, and gaps at the joints that let exhaust leak into wall cavities. A Level-2 camera inspection catches this before it becomes a carbon monoxide risk.
- Rusted throat dampers from coastal humidity. The elevated moisture in northeastern Bronx air, especially within a mile of Eastchester Bay, corrodes steel damper frames faster than inland neighborhoods. Baychester homeowners often don’t realize their damper is stuck open until the heating bill spikes.
- Improperly sized flues for fireplace inserts. Homeowners install inserts to avoid rebuilding an oversized chimney, then discover the existing flue is too large to vent the insert efficiently. The result is creosote buildup in wood units or condensate pooling in gas units, both of which accelerate liner damage.
- Efflorescence and spalling on exterior chimney brick. That same bay humidity pushes salt through mortar joints, leaving white powder and eventually flaking the brick face. It’s not just cosmetic; spalled brick loses its protective shell and absorbs more water, accelerating freeze-thaw damage each winter.
Pricing for Fireplace Services in Baychester, NY
Here’s what fireplace service costs in the Baychester market, based on the homes we actually work on:
| Service | Typical Range in Baychester |
|---|---|
| Gas fireplace tune-up and inspection | $150 - $280 |
| Wood-burning chimney cleaning + Level-2 inspection | $200 - $350 |
| Damper repair or replacement (throat) | $180 - $450 |
| Top-sealing damper installation | $600 - $950 |
| Firebox refractory panel replacement | $400 - $800 |
| Firebox rebuild (HeatShield or firebrick) | $1,200 - $2,400 |
| Fireplace insert with stainless liner | $2,800 - $4,500 |
| Fireplace conversion (gas, with liner/gas work) | $3,500 - $6,000 |
These ranges reflect Baychester’s specific housing stock: older masonry, often with access constraints in attached homes, and the additional liner work that most jobs here require.
